**TICKET-2291: WebSocket compression eating CPU on Pondside relay**

Enabling permessage-deflate cut bandwidth ~60% but CPU on the relay nodes jumped noticeably during peak. Proposal for sync: compress only messages over 1KB and skip the chatty heartbeats. Repro and flamegraphs attached. The build I profiled against is noted below.

build token for bafop-fahag: htk31_54fa17da51a5745f4aae16134587efa

= Document Transport: Sealed Exam Papers =

This page covers the delivery of sealed examination papers from Hallowick Assessment House to the Oradell testing centre. Papers arrive in numbered security satchels with dual tamper seals; both seals must be intact on receipt. Check satchel numbers against the advance list, photograph each seal, and store satchels in the locked document safe immediately — never on open shelving. Receipt must be countersigned by two staff members. When the courier arrives, follow the agreed hand-over protocol exactly.

handover note for tadug-yaguf: the aldath pelwyn courier leaves the casox norwyn briix silok zorok kasdor aldion quenox ledger at gate 2653 under passcode 959015

MEMO — Marketing Budget Adjustment

To: Heads of Department

Effective next quarter, the marketing budget is reduced by 18%. Sponsorships under the Fenwick Trail programme are paused, and the Solmere campaign will be scaled back to digital channels only. Headcount is unaffected. Department heads should submit revised spend plans within ten working days. Reallocation priorities will be confirmed at the planning session in Harrowgate House. The confidential rationale tied to broader business plans is noted below.

board note of bawep-tajef: Queniusek Systems plans to raise the Quenvan list price by 53.1 percent in March. The pricing group signed off on a budget of $176.4 million for Project Drueth. The renewal with Casionix Partners closes at $142.5 million a year, 8.3 percent below the last contract. Project Fraax slips by six weeks because of the tooling delay.